88 XR7 no dash at all help!?!?!

Reply #8
Quote from: mtflyboy25@gmail.com;413123
okay... So I basically cheated.  My alternator was not charging at all because it was getting 0 signal from the green wire... The one that apparently comes from the dash...
The voltage is supposed to come from the IGNITION SWITCH and go through the alternator warning light on the dash, and then on the green wire to the Alt. regulator.

Quote
So I clipped it into the hot wire next to it that runs 12v.  This made the alternator charge like it was supposed to.. So that is done, I get in the car and notice I can almost make out the gauges.  They are working...
You need to disconnect this jumper when the engine is turned off, or it will drain your battery.

 

Quote
I replaced the ignition relay and this seems to help.
??? Do you mean the starter relay? 

Quote
BUT I have to have the key turned exactly right to have the gauges, turn signals, and heater/ac blower work.... 

Any advice?
Yes!! Replace the ignition switch before it catches on fire!!

88 XR7 no dash at all help!?!?!

Reply #12
If you can barely see the dash display it means it's working, but the backlighting isn't. This is almost certainly a bad cluster illumination relay, which, IIRC, is in the area behind the radio toward the driver's side. It might also be the halogen bulbs burned out, but this is less likely as there are six of them and sudden failure of the lot of them is unlikely...
